media: i2c: dw9714: Return zero in remove callback
authorUwe Kleine-König <u.kleine-koenig@pengutronix.de>
Thu, 31 Mar 2022 13:31:32 +0000 (14:31 +0100)
committerMauro Carvalho Chehab <mchehab@kernel.org>
Sun, 24 Apr 2022 07:26:45 +0000 (08:26 +0100)
commitb4657e00115d0c87970a2386338b70fa95ef4ac6
treefd4f064e8d8bc8a4f1a075a1d9fcd33115958555
parent02276e18defa2fccf16413b44440277d98c2b1ea
media: i2c: dw9714: Return zero in remove callback

The only effect of returning an error code in an i2c remove callback is
that the i2c core emits a generic warning and still removes the device.

So even if disabling the regulator fails it's sensible to further cleanup
and then return zero to only emit a single error message.

This patch is a preparation for making i2c remove callbacks return void.

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Signed-off-by: Sakari Ailus <sakari.ailus@linux.intel.com>
Signed-off-by: Mauro Carvalho Chehab <mchehab@kernel.org>
drivers/media/i2c/dw9714.c